Cal Pep
Pl. Olles 8 located in the El Born area It is in a courtyard The food at Cal Pep is simply delicious. The ingredients are local and very simply prepared in front of you. The place to sit is at the counter (not the dining room). It is always crowded and you can expect to wait, but worth every minute. One fo the best food experiences that I had in BCN, I let the server order for me. . I especially love the Clams, the articokes, calamari...and the list goes on We went again the day before we left. For 2 persons with a bottle of house wine $70Eur |

Hope you have a truly great time in Barcelona and beyond! domesticgodess, I'll second the above and can add another: "Paco Meralgo Alta Taberna" in the Esquerra (Left) Eixample on the corner of Córsega and Muntaner. It's something between a restaurant and tapas bar, a little of both. Actually the servings aren't tapas size, but "entrants" or "medias raciones", half servings, and plates of the day, plus desserts and a great wine list. Long, high counters with bar stools all around the room. Always packed, so you will need to be seated early (by nine) and possibly have to wait for a space. It's a great place to go with a group to share plates. Delicious seafood like their gambas de Palamós (grilled shrimp). This is the perfect place for a casual meal if you're staying at one of the Eixample hotels too and open Sunday. It's the "buzzy" Cal Pep of the Eixample. |
